Turning off WiFi when you’re not using it and turning it on only when needed can help save a bit of battery life by preventing data syncing. It will be useful when you go to sleep, if you want to avoid being distracted during work hours, or there is no WiFi, so it would not make sense that the cell phone is constantly scanning or searching for networks.

If you are tired of lowering the notification bar to constantly turn off or on the WiFi, you can automate this task, so that it is deactivated during certain hours and is activated at X time. In some devices that have this feature integrated into their settings. In case your cell phone does not have it, you can use a third-party application, such as WiFi Auto Connect o WiFi Automatic, the Wifi app Auto Off or better yet Tasker, or where you can turn the WiFi on or off depending on the status of the screen (off or on).

For example, some Samsung mobiles incorporate an option in the Android system settings, Wireless connections, WiFi, Advanced, WiFi timer, which allows you to turn the WiFi on or off depending on the time of day. This tuning is likely to be found on a similar path on other makes and models as well.

In this case, the start and end time corresponds to the time when the WiFi will turn on and off respectively. If both are activated, it means that the WiFi will remain active in that period of time and outside of those hours it will turn off. If you only activate the start box, it will always turn on at that time. If you check only the end box, the WiFi will turn off whenever that time arrives.

Once the WiFi is activated automatically, a notification will appear in the status bar. In the same way when the WiFi hardware is turned off in an automated way.

Third party apps

WiFi Auto Connect – Auto WiFi (Descargar): From between varias apps of the WiFi timer that exist in the Play Store, I have tried this one that is updated, it seems the most complete and best rated. It was required on my new Samsung Galaxy S7, which does not have the timer option.

You simply have to activate it and select any of the available conditions. The only thing I need to clarify about it is that it does not turn off the WiFi immediately at the scheduled minute. In my tests it has done it several seconds after the set time.

Bags: Although this is a paid application, it is worth it for its ability to schedule any task, including the ability to turn off the WiFi hardware after a certain time or automatically turn it on at X time.

In this case the program is simple. Tap on the “+” to create a profile, choose “Time” and select the space of time (or the same time). Now click on the return arrow, tap on «New Task» and put any name. Finally, tap on the “+” to add an action, choose “Network”, “WiFi” and indicate if you want to “Turn it off” or “Turn it on”. If you return a couple of times, your profile will already be created and ready to go live at the scheduled time.

If you have problems with these types of apps, try going to the system settings, Applications, Application name. Near the end there should be the “Apps that change system settings” section. Tap there and then enable the “Grant permission” switch.
